"A Key To Bottarelli's Italian Exercises" is an invaluable resource for students of the Italian language, designed to be used in conjunction with Veneroni's renowned grammar. This key, featuring exercises and extracts in both prose and verse, offers a practical approach to mastering Italian grammar and composition. Compiled by Pietro Ricci Rota and Ferdinando Bottarelli, the work provides detailed solutions and explanations, enabling learners to reinforce their understanding and refine their skills. The extracts in prose and verse enhance the learning experience by exposing students to authentic Italian literature.
This edition preserves the historical context and pedagogical value of the original work, making it a valuable addition to any Italian language learning collection. It provides a unique glimpse into 18th-century language education, showcasing the methods and materials used to teach Italian to foreign learners.
